Beginning at the cervical trachea, the animation tracks airflow inferiorly to the carina and into the right and left main bronchi as they pass posterior to the great vessels and enter the pulmonary hila. Branching proceeds in sequence through the lobar (secondary) bronchi and onward to segmental (tertiary) bronchi, with each division positioned more laterally and distally within the lung parenchyma. Cartilage transitions from C shaped tracheal rings to irregular bronchial plates, while the bronchioles appear as progressively smaller, cartilage-free tubes with a thicker relative smooth muscle layer. Orientation stays anatomical, clarifying the more vertical, wider right main bronchus compared with the longer, more oblique left. Airway anatomy is a landmark map for bronchoscopy, endotracheal tube positioning, and interpreting CT findings around the central bronchi and peribronchovascular interstitium. The sequential branching clarifies why aspirated material and misplaced suction catheters tend to track into the right bronchial tree, and it lets you follow how mucus plugging or a bronchogenic carcinoma can obstruct a single segmental bronchus while leaving adjacent segments aerated. Seeing cartilage support taper and disappear as bronchi become bronchioles also sets up the physiology behind wheeze in asthma and airflow limitation in COPD. Small changes matter.
